new miglia builder
 
hi all
my name is ian, and I have been reading all your posts avidly for some time now. Think this site is really great, all your builds look first class, and the ideas you spread about are very helpfull and thought provoking.
I decided a few month ago to try and build a miglia speedster, think the car and idea are brilliant. I built a jc midge around 12 years ago, on a 2ltr vitesse chassis, and have restored numerous classics, a mg midget, a Morris's minor pick up, and a 1926 morris 8.
although the midge gave me the most satisfaction of the lot. So I have bought myself a 1964 1600 six vitesse, which I have started to recondition to a rolling chassis base, ready to attach a miglia body. I have no time scale as yet, but engine as been reckoned, and gear box back on. chassis members have been changed as required, but it is not painted yet, and running gear req,s refurb.
Not placed any deposit for kit yet as space is a premium, living in a three storey house with an integral garage ( and a misses who finds me plenty of other things to do) hope she,s not reading this. Any way I will keep you posted on progress , and hope to post some pics, nice to be able to join in, catch you all later, thanks.
